On October 8, AERA joined 17 scientific organizations and higher education groups on a letter urging the National Science Foundation (NSF) to include measures related to sexual orientation and gender identity on the 2019 Survey of Doctorate Recipients. Similar to the letter sent to NSF on data collection for the National Survey of College Graduates, this letter highlights the importance and feasibility of including questions that would enhance data currently collected and reported in Science and Engineering Indicators and Women, Minorities, and Persons with Disabilities in Science and Engineering.

The letter also references the recommendations for enhancing surveys with the inclusion of gender identity and sexual orientation measures included in the AERA publication LGBTQ Issues in Education: Advancing a Research Agenda.  On October 29, the Federal Register published a proposed collection from NSF for the next series of the Survey of Earned Doctorates. Public comments are due on December 28.
